Video Streaming vs. Video-on-Demand: What's the Difference?
While often used synonymously , video streaming and video-on-demand (VOD) represent different approaches to enjoying content. Video delivery generally refers to content that is sent in real-time, like a sporting event, requiring a continuous connection to the source . Conversely, VOD allows you to choose what you want to see and when, offering a library of videos available at your convenience. Essentially, broadcasting is about the immediacy of the experience, whereas VOD prioritizes flexibility and accessibility.

Ensuring Consistent & Superior Video Delivery
To guarantee a seamless streaming presentation for your users, adopting multiple procedures is critical . Give attention to network tuning , including media encoding at optimal bitrates for the typical bandwidth .
